In a moment that underscored the power of democracy and the trust of the people, the Lagos State Independent Electoral Commission (LASIEC) on Wednesday, July 16, 2025, presented Certificates of Return to Hon. Ismail Monsuru Akinloye and Hon. Lateef Adesanya as the duly elected Executive Chairman and Vice Chairman of Eredo Local Council Development Area (LCDA).
Ekohotblog reports that the presentation ceremony, held at LASIEC headquarters, marked the formal conclusion of the 2025 local government elections and a renewed mandate for the duo to lead Eredo into a new era of service, development, and people-centered governance.

Addressing the gathering shortly after receiving his certificate, Hon. Akinloye described the moment as both humbling and inspiring.
“This isn’t just a certificate. It is a symbol of trust, a reward for consistency, and a renewed call to serve,” he said. “It represents the voice of the people boldly heard, and a mandate to do even more for the great people of Eredo.”
The Vice Chairman-Elect, Hon. Lateef Adesanya, also expressed appreciation to the people and promised a strong partnership with the Chairman to ensure effective governance at the grassroots.
“We are committed to unity in leadership, to delivering results that matter, and to running a responsive administration that listens and acts,” he said.
LASIEC Chairman, Hon. Justice Bola Okikiolu-Ighile (Rtd.), while presenting the certificates, congratulated all the elected candidates and commended Lagosians for their peaceful participation in the electoral process.
“This exercise reflects the strength of our institutions and the maturity of our democracy,” she said. “We urge all elected officials to justify the confidence reposed in them.”
For many residents of Eredo, the return of Akinloye signals continuity in development, transparency, and accessibility. His previous administration earned praise for its investments in rural infrastructure, youth empowerment, healthcare access, and education.

As the local government prepares for the official swearing-in, expectations are high that the second term of Hon. Akinloye and Hon. Adesanya will bring about deeper engagement with the people and accelerated development across communities.
“The journey to greatness continues,” Akinloye declared. “We move forward with greater purpose, clearer vision, and unshakable commitment to the progress of Eredo LCDA.”
